An SBA loan for a small business is a financing option partially guaranteed by the federal government to lower risk for lenders. You need this when you want to expand your operations, buy equipment, or manage daily overhead with more favorable terms than traditional bank financing. Because the government backs a portion of the debt, these loans are often more accessible for growing companies. Factors like your credit history and cash flow influence your rates. Who is eligible for an SBA loan?

To be eligible for an SBA loan, your business generally needs to be a for-profit U.S. based enterprise, meet SBA size standards, and be able to demonstrate repayment ability. What does an SBA loan mean?

An SBA loan means the U.S. Small Business Administration partially guarantees the loan amount, reducing the risk for the lending institution. This often allows small businesses in Wichita to access larger loan amounts, secure better interest rates, and get longer repayment terms than they might with traditional bank loans.
